    Unveiling Mansfield's Rich History

    Mansfield's history is as fascinating as it is long, dating back to Roman times. The town has seen its share of ups and downs, but it has always managed to reinvent itself. The town’s strategic location, near Sherwood Forest, played a crucial role in its early development. The Romans were the first to recognize the area's significance, establishing a settlement that would later evolve into the town we know today. Over the centuries, Mansfield grew and prospered, its fortunes tied to various industries. The medieval period saw the rise of the wool trade, which brought prosperity to the area. Many historic buildings and structures still stand, telling stories of its past. The Industrial Revolution marked a turning point, with Mansfield becoming a significant center for textile and coal mining. This era brought both progress and challenges, shaping the town’s character and its people. The town's industrial past is visible in its architecture and the remnants of factories and mines that dot the landscape. Understanding Mansfield's history is key to appreciating its present.     The Growth and Development of Mansfield

    The growth and development of Mansfield can be traced through several key periods, each leaving its mark on the town's character and infrastructure. From its early Roman settlements to its emergence as an industrial powerhouse, Mansfield's evolution has been shaped by its location, resources, and the resilience of its inhabitants. Let's break down these significant phases:

    • Roman Era: The Romans recognized the strategic importance of the area, establishing a settlement here, which laid the foundation for future growth. Their infrastructure and influence were pivotal in shaping the early development of the region.
    • Medieval Period: During the medieval era, Mansfield flourished as a market town. The wool trade became a key economic driver, attracting merchants and craftsmen. The Market Place became the center of commerce, setting the stage for future growth.
    • Industrial Revolution: This was a transformative period for Mansfield. Textile mills and coal mines sprung up, transforming the town into a key industrial center. This brought about significant population growth and infrastructure development.
    • 20th Century and Beyond: In the 20th and 21st centuries, Mansfield has faced the decline of its traditional industries, but it has also shown remarkable adaptability. The town diversified its economy, focusing on retail, services, and tourism. New developments and regeneration projects have breathed new life into the town, creating a vibrant mix of old and new.

    Sherwood Forest

    No trip to this area is complete without a visit to Sherwood Forest. This legendary forest is famous as the home of Robin Hood, the heroic outlaw. It’s just a short drive from Mansfield. You can walk among ancient trees, including the iconic Major Oak, a massive oak tree estimated to be over 800 years old. Imagine the stories that tree could tell! Sherwood Forest is a great spot for nature lovers and families. It offers trails for hiking and cycling, as well as visitor centers and interactive displays. You can even join guided tours to learn more about the forest's history and the legend of Robin Hood.     Pleasley Pit Country Park

    For a glimpse into Mansfield's industrial past, Pleasley Pit Country Park is a fascinating spot. This park is built on the site of a former coal mine, offering a unique blend of history and nature. You can see the preserved headstocks of the mine, which stand as a reminder of the town's industrial heritage. It’s a poignant spot that pays tribute to the miners. The park also has walking trails, ponds, and green spaces, making it a great place for a relaxing day out.
